...difficulty from philanthropic men interested in the sort of work the Union is doing; but the same amount of money coming from college men will have many times the value to the Union. It is the connection of the Union with the college which makes it attractive to the young mechanics and laborers who are members. They like to feel that Harvard students are enough interested in this work to unite with them to bear the burden of its financial support. It is evidence that we expect to receive as well as to give in our intercourse with them...
